Description of problem:



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):


How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. install rh7.2 inside a vmware guest
2. run startx

Actual Results:  X and gnome should start up

Expected Results:  the server aborts. Relevant error text is:
Symbol mfbQueryBestSize from module
/usr/X11R6/lib/modules/drivers/vmware_drv.o
 is unresolved!

...
        This should not happen!
        An unresolved function was called!

Fatal server error

Additional info:

Adding 
Load "mfb"
to the Modules section allows the X server to start.
(It crashes soon after that, but that may be because I'm using a beta
of vmware 3. The problem in _this_ report shouldn't be dependent on that)
